Place Portrait

A digitally enabled evidence-base, powered by AI

We create a digitally enabled ‘single source of truth’ for your place, curated through an interactive and intuitive user interface.

Our Place Portraits are intended to empower teams, not just inform them. They give users the tools to independently explore data, test ideas, and build a deeper, more robust understanding of place.

Place Insights

Data-driven insights to guide decision-making

We uncover dynamics that drive place performance to inform future solutions – from proposed spatial frameworks and strategies for high street regeneration to assessments for improving health & wellbeing, long-term economic case-making and future-proofing infrastructure.

Outputs are tailored to each local challenge, from interactive dashboards and engagement-ready visualisations, to compelling digital storytelling.

Place Scenarios

Live and dynamic scenario testing to understand impact

We develop tailored digital sandbox tools that let our clients explore potential futures, evaluate their performance, and understand the impact of major decisions, before they’re made.

Behind the interface sits a powerful engine which synthesises diverse datasets into one coherent spatial understanding of how places work.
